summaryrefslogtreecommitdiff
path: root/trunk
diff options
context:
space:
mode:
Diffstat (limited to 'trunk')
-rw-r--r--trunk/ChangeLog3
-rw-r--r--trunk/Makefile3
-rwxr-xr-xtrunk/release.sh5
-rwxr-xr-xtrunk/src/euse/euse7
-rw-r--r--trunk/src/glsa-check/Makefile1
5 files changed, 17 insertions, 2 deletions
diff --git a/trunk/ChangeLog b/trunk/ChangeLog
index be0a39c..3889277 100644
--- a/trunk/ChangeLog
+++ b/trunk/ChangeLog
@@ -1,3 +1,6 @@
+2005-04-07 Marius Mauch <genone@gentoo.org>
+ * euse: fixed bugs 74344, 75525 and 84521
+
2005-03-12 Aron Griffis <agriffis@gentoo.org>
* Added eviewcvs to -dev, utility for generating viewcvs URLs
diff --git a/trunk/Makefile b/trunk/Makefile
index 7a1693f..58f5385 100644
--- a/trunk/Makefile
+++ b/trunk/Makefile
@@ -16,6 +16,9 @@ all:
echo $(sbindir)
echo $(mandir)
+clean:
+ rm -rf release/*
+
dist:
echo "Err0r: Must use either dist-gentoolkit or dist-gentoolkit-dev"
exit 1
diff --git a/trunk/release.sh b/trunk/release.sh
index 2c8b937..cee80c1 100755
--- a/trunk/release.sh
+++ b/trunk/release.sh
@@ -10,6 +10,11 @@ elif [ "$(whoami)" == "port001" ] ; then
publish_public_path="http://dev.gentoo.org/~port001/distfiles/gentoolkit/releases"
portdir=/home/port001/Gentoo/gentoo-x86/
export ECHANGELOG_USER="Ian Leitch <port001@gentoo.org>"
+elif [ "$(whoami)" == "genone" ]; then
+ publish_path=dev:public_html/distfiles/
+ publish_public_path="http://dev.gentoo.org/~genone/distfiles/"
+ portdir=/home/gentoo/cvs/gentoo-x86/
+ export ECHANGELOG_USER="Marius Mauch <genone@gentoo.org>"
else
echo "!!! Don't know who $(whoami) is, can't release"
exit 1
diff --git a/trunk/src/euse/euse b/trunk/src/euse/euse
index f2972ad..d663233 100755
--- a/trunk/src/euse/euse
+++ b/trunk/src/euse/euse
@@ -47,6 +47,7 @@ parse_arguments() {
error() {
echo "ERROR: ${1}"
+ set +f
exit 1
}
@@ -58,7 +59,7 @@ check_sanity() {
[ ! -r "${MAKE_CONF_PATH}" ] && error "${MAKE_CONF_PATH} is not readable"
[ ! -r "${MAKE_GLOBALS_PATH}" ] && error "${MAKE_GLOBALS_PATH} is not readable"
- [ ! -s "${MAKE_PROFILE_PATH}" ] && error "${MAKE_PROFILE_PATH} is not a symlink"
+ [ ! -h "${MAKE_PROFILE_PATH}" ] && error "${MAKE_PROFILE_PATH} is not a symlink"
[ -z "$(get_portdir)" ] && error "\$PORTDIR couldn't be determined"
[ ! -d "${descdir}" ] && error "${descdir} does not exist or is not a directory"
[ ! -r "${descdir}/use.desc" ] && error "${descdir}/use.desc is not readable"
@@ -154,7 +155,7 @@ get_make_defaults() {
curdir="$(readlink -f ${MAKE_PROFILE_PATH})"
while [ ! -f "${curdir}/make.defaults" -a -f "${curdir}/parent" ]; do
- parent="$(grep -v '(^#|^ *$)' ${curdir}/parent)"
+ parent="$(egrep -v '(^#|^ *$)' ${curdir}/parent)"
curdir="$(readlink -f ${curdir}/${parent})"
done
@@ -383,7 +384,9 @@ modify() {
##### main program comes now #####
+set -f
parse_arguments "$@"
check_sanity
eval ${MODE} ${ARGUMENTS}
+set +f
diff --git a/trunk/src/glsa-check/Makefile b/trunk/src/glsa-check/Makefile
index 8c6fa6d..a3f1044 100644
--- a/trunk/src/glsa-check/Makefile
+++ b/trunk/src/glsa-check/Makefile
@@ -14,5 +14,6 @@ dist:
cp Makefile glsa.py glsa-check ../../$(distdir)/src/glsa-check/
install:
+ install -d $(DESTDIR)/usr/lib/gentoolkit/pym/
install -m 0755 glsa-check $(bindir)/
install -m 0644 glsa.py $(DESTDIR)/usr/lib/gentoolkit/pym/